Course Content

• Food Microbiology and Pathogen Detection
• Principles of Food Safety and Hazard Analysis
• Risk Assessment Methodologies in Food Contamination
• Food Chemistry and Contaminant Analysis (including mycotoxins and pesticides)
• Quantitative Risk Assessment for Foodborne Illness
• Food Processing and Contamination Control
• Foodborne Illness Epidemiology and Outbreak Investigation
• Regulatory Frameworks for Food Safety and Contamination
• Communication and Risk Management in Food Safety

A Graduate Certificate in Food Contamination Risk Assessment equips students with the advanced knowledge and skills necessary to identify, analyze, and manage food safety hazards throughout the entire food chain. This specialized program focuses on developing a robust understanding of risk assessment principles, methodologies, and their practical application within the food industry.


Learning outcomes typically include mastering quantitative microbial risk assessment techniques, understanding foodborne illness epidemiology, and applying critical thinking skills to complex food safety challenges. Graduates will be proficient in designing and implementing effective food safety management systems, including Hazard Analysis and Critical Control Points (HACCP) principles. The program also emphasizes regulatory compliance and the communication of risk assessment findings to various stakeholders.
